Summary     : Java CIM Client library
Description :
The purpose of this package is to provide a CIM Client Class Library for Java
applications. It complies to the DMTF standard CIM Operations over HTTP and
intends to be compatible with JCP JSR48 once it becomes available. To learn
more about DMTF visit http://www.dmtf.org.
